Ratcher & Clank Film Releases to Negative Reviews, Earns $4.7 Million Over Weekend

The cinematic adaptation of the classic platformer isn't exactly doing great.

While Insomniac’s Ratchet & Clank on the PS4 is the fastest-selling entry in the series till date, the CG film it’s meant to tie into hasn’t been as great. It’s received quite the negative response overall from critics and now Deadline has reported on its box office numbers.

In its first weekend, the Ratchet & Clank film (shown at 2891 theaters) managed to earn $4.7 million. It brought in $1.4 million Friday, $1.99 million on Saturday and $1.3 million on Sunday. While the film’s budget isn’t known at this time, it’s revenue is unlikely to go up in the long run.

Contrast this to Disney’s The Jungle Book which released on April 15th and targeted at a similar demographic, bringing in $42.4 million in its third weekend.
